**Q: How do idempotency keys work for payment retries in Centavo?**

A: Every payment request must carry a client-generated idempotency key. If a retry arrives with the same key, Centavo returns the stored result instead of charging again. Keys are scoped per merchant account and expire after 48 hours, so retries beyond that window create new charges. Do not reuse keys across distinct payment intents — this is the most common integration mistake we see. For the key format, storage semantics, and edge cases, see the spec here:

wiki page, fahaf-yagag: https://confluence.qorvellabs.internal/pages/display/pages/display

Hi,

Taking over from me this cycle, here's the state of things. The v9 pagination change (cursor tokens replacing offset params) ships Thursday; deprecation headers are already live on offset endpoints. Watch the Copperfen integration tests — they still assume page numbers and will flag false failures until their fix merges. Changelog draft is in the usual folder. Release artifacts go through the standard publish script, which signs the bundle before pushing to the gateway. The signing key it expects is below.

rollout seal: bky4_x7Gc

## Step 4: Reconfigure the chip readers

After moving the Striderline timing-chip readers to the new ingest endpoint, each reader must be re-enrolled before it will accept race-day traffic. Enrollment now requires mutual TLS; the legacy shared-token path is removed in this version, which closes the replay issue flagged in last season's audit. Readers that fail enrollment fall back to local buffering only and never transmit in the clear. Apply the configuration shown below to each unit.

deployment values, kajep-kageg:
[praix]
host = praix.paliqcorp.corp
user = praix_svc
database = praix_prod